#if !defined(__COGL_H_INSIDE__) && !defined(COGL_COMPILATION)
#error "Only <cogl/cogl.h> can be included directly."
#endif
#ifndef __COGL_KMS_DISPLAY_H__
#define __COGL_KMS_DISPLAY_H__
#include <cogl/cogl-types.h>
#include <cogl/cogl-display.h>
G_BEGIN_DECLS
/**
* cogl_kms_display_queue_modes_reset:
* @display: A #CoglDisplay
*
* Asks Cogl to explicitly reset the crtc output modes at the next
* #CoglOnscreen swap_buffers request. For applications that support
* VT switching they may want to re-assert the output modes when
* switching back to the applications VT since the modes are often not
* correctly restored automatically.
*
* <note>The @display must have been either explicitly setup via
* cogl_display_setup() or implicitily setup by having created a
* context using the @display</note>
*
* Since: 2.0
* Stability: unstable
*/
void
cogl_kms_display_queue_modes_reset (CoglDisplay *display);
G_END_DECLS
#endif /* __COGL_KMS_DISPLAY_H__ */
